Atrisināts: Chrome paplašinājums iegūst pašreizējās cilnes URL

Galvenā problēma ir tā, ka Chrome paplašinājumiem nav piekļuves rekvizītam window.currentTab. Tas nozīmē, ka viņi nevar iegūt pašreizējās cilnes URL.

chrome.tabs.query({'active': true, 'lastFocusedWindow': true}, function (tabs) {
    var url = tabs[0].url;
});

Šis kods izmanto chrome.tabs API, lai vaicātu par aktīvo cilni pēdējā atlasītajā logā. Atzvanīšanas funkcijai tiek nodots ciļņu masīvs, un aktīvās cilnes URL tiek izgūts no šī masīva pirmā elementa.

JavaScript Chrome paplašinājumi

JavaScript Chrome paplašinājumi ir paplašinājumi, kurus var instalēt pārlūkprogrammā Google Chrome. Tie ļauj veikt tādas darbības kā, piemēram, pievienot pārlūkprogrammai jaunas funkcijas, saglabāt iecienītākās vietnes un veikt citas darbības.

Labākais Chrome paplašinājums darbam JavaScript

Ir daudz lielisku Chrome paplašinājumu, ko var izmantot JavaScript. Daži no labākajiem ietver:

1. CodeMirror: Šis ir lielisks paplašinājums, kas ļauj rediģēt un priekšskatīt kodu pārlūkprogrammā. Tam ir arī iebūvēts JavaScript redaktors, kas atvieglo koda rakstīšanu un testēšanu.

2. JS Bin: šis ir vēl viens lielisks paplašinājums, kas ļauj ātri pārbaudīt un atkļūdot kodu pārlūkprogrammā. Tam ir arī iebūvēts JavaScript redaktors, kas atvieglo koda rakstīšanu un testēšanu.

3. JSLint: JSLint ir lielisks paplašinājums, kas palīdz pārbaudīt, vai kodā nav kļūdu un iespējamās problēmas. Tam ir arī iebūvēts JavaScript redaktors, kas atvieglo koda rakstīšanu un testēšanu.

Related posts:

Leave a Comment